Question Is zaino better than eagle one and meguiars?

I have heard a lot of positives about the zaino polishes and waxes. Why have i never seen their products in an auto store? or at any major car shows?

Is this stuff better than eagle one or meguiars products?

Zaino is not sold in auto parts stores, only thru the home office and distributors like myself, there are far, far more waxes and polish in existence that are NOT sold in stores than are sold in stores.
